Is worth a salary going back such as Vesey, and a couple draft picks... a 2nd and a 4th perhaps. With them retaining salary. In previous deals Pearson cost Pittsburgh Hagelin (a 3rd liner) and then cost Vancouver Gudbransson (a 5-6 dman). In neither of those deals was Pearson a rental... so no chance Leafs would pay substantially more than those prices even with retained salary
